VietPride Week
in Saigon

The wait is over, you’re now looking at the official VietPride HCMC Week 2024 Schedule, consisting of almost 20 events, taking place all over the city in 8 days from 21/9/2024 to 29/9/2024. Pride everywhere, Pride for everyone! The event will take place in different places in Saigon, including talks, meetings, a ballroom, conferences on LGBTQ+ local community, performances and a short parade right in the walking street Nguyen Hue Boulevard.

Family of 3 generations making tofu in Hoi An Come to hear the stories and learn how to make tofu.

Among the delightful deserts in Hoi An, tào phớ (fresh tofu) í the most popular one. It’s a silky tofu pudding lusciously adorned with fragrant ginger syrup, creamy coconut milk, and occasionally topped with a refreshing layer of crushed ice. These authentic and freshly prepared desserts are also reimagined in modern variations at some cafes and dessert shops.

Hideaway in a small alley is a cozy house of a famous tofu maker. His grandfather started making tofu business nearly 100 years ago, and the recipe is passed down to him – the third generation. He will show you how to make the fresh tofu and top it with ginger syrup to become a tasty treat. Also, try to make some fried tofu which is a popular ingredient in Vietnamese vegetarian dishes.

First direct flight between
Vietnam and Bhutan

It’s great to know that Bhutan Airlines will launch the first direct service to Vietnam, connecting HCMC and Paro in 2025. The plan to operate 10 round-trip flights annually using Airbus aircraft is quite exciting.

The cost for a round trip is expected to be around US$1,200 for business class and US$ 900 for the economy, providing more options for travelers between the two countries. This direct service will alleviate the current need to transit through Thailand or India. Paro Airport’s unique location, with an altitude of over 2,400 meters and surrounded by high mountains, definitely poses a challenge for landing and takeoff, making it one of the most challenging airports in the world.
